DE10 UCJ is a 2010 Seat Exeo in Blue with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.

Across all 2010 Seat Exeo models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.8% with a typical mileage of 100,099 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Seat Exeo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,618 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DE10 UCJ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Seat Exeo typ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 16 years old, this Seat Exeo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
